Senior Director, Innovative Research Methods

AstraZeneca is a company that follows the science and turns ideas into life changing medicines. The Senior Director, Innovative Research Methods will be responsible for setting the innovation agenda in evidence generation for oncology, leading multiple initiatives, and collaborating with cross-functional teams to enhance efficiencies in clinical studies.

Responsibilities

Be responsible for multiple initiatives within NGS and EG2P, and therefore must be comfortable with ambiguity and able to flex across different workstreams, cross-functional teams and discussion topics
Conceive and pilot innovations related to the conduct of clinical studies, including recruitment, data collection, data management or analysis that enhance efficiencies or reduce burden across multiple tumour types, geographies and settings
Lead external academic partnerships, method co-development (e.g., external control arms, EMR-to-EDC pipelines, synthetic arms, DCT design science), and cross-AZ alignment with R&D Biostatistics, Data Science/ML, and Regulatory to ensure consistency and scientific rigor
Inform the development of plans and playbooks that clearly outline key steps for implementation of identified innovations within current workstreams to increase adoption across study teams
Collaborate closely with internal global cross-functional partners including broader Evidence Generation to Publications (EG2P) team, Oncology Medical Affairs leadership and global Medical teams to enable implementation of new / innovative approaches to data collection, generation or communication
Outline EG2P’s strategy for innovative digital health or Artificial Intelligence (AI) solutions for evidence generation (including use-cases, risk taxonomy, validation frameworks, etc) and seek opportunities for innovation and simplification
Be a thought partner in optimizing data collection in projects led by EG2P organization, such as Phase 3b/4 studies, ESRs, or where applicable, EAPs, including publication of position papers/guidance and contributions to industry standards
Lead discussions within broader AZ organization, including Research & Development, regarding trends in clinical research innovation
Provide leadership, mentor, feed forward to teams and individuals to upskill and develop future capabilities in line with AstraZeneca’s dedication to a culture of performance development and lifelong learning
Lead stewardship of method qualification, evidentiary standards, and regulatory engagement (e.g., dialogues on RWE/external controls, DCT acceptability), ensuring methods meet ICH/GCP and regional expectations before handoff to DIRA

Qualification

Clinical operationsBiostatisticsDigital healthOncology expertiseGenerative AIClinical PracticeProblem resolution skillsCommunication skillsTeam collaboration

Required

MS, PharmD or PhD in relevant scientific subject area (outcomes research, epidemiology, biostatistics)
Minimum 10 years' experience in the pharmaceutical industry / consulting with proven track record in clinical operations, clinical development, biostatistics, digital health or related subject areas
Ability to be creative and collaborate on innovative research methods for conducting prospective / clinical studies
Proven experience in conducting innovative study approaches, including decentralized trials, creation of external control arms, using EMR to EDC or digital health tools for data collection
Recognized as a subject matter authority with deep technical expertise with Phase 3b/4 clinical trials, generation of real world evidence, and HEOR projects
Deep understanding of Good Clinical Practice (GCP), US and Global technical and regulatory requirements for conducting clinical studies
Strong verbal and written communication skills, particularly related to conducting clinical research

Preferred

Scientific and business expertise in oncology with a strong understanding of key global and regional issues and concerns
Experience / knowledge of application of GenAI solutions within the medical affairs or evidence generation fields
Familiarity with the latest research and thinking
Effective problem and conflict resolution skills and validated team focus
Proven track record of operating within cross-functional / matrixed environment, displaying ability to partner with other collaborators / teams
